St. Nikolaus Provost Church captivates with its Gothic Revival architecture and rich history. Since opening in 1893, it has stood as Kiel's oldest Roman Catholic church, bearing witness to the city's spiritual depth. The intricate stained glass and pointed arches create an awe-inspiring ambiance that invites reflection.

Did you know?

The church was damaged during the bombing of Kiel in World War II.
